**Management Meeting Minutes – Franchise Agreement**

Present: Dept heads, plus Rowan from Legal.

Main item: the Copperfield Kitchens franchise deal. Rowan walked us through the revised agreement — territory rights sorted, royalty rate settled at last. Marketing raised the co-branding question again; parked for next month. Everyone agreed we're ready to sign once the audit wraps. Nice work all round, honestly quicker than expected. The thinking behind the rollout sequence is noted below.

board note of bawep-tajef: Queniusek Systems plans to raise the Quenvan list price by 53.1 percent in March. The pricing group signed off on a budget of $176.4 million for Project Drueth. The renewal with Casionix Partners closes at $142.5 million a year, 8.3 percent below the last contract. Project Fraax slips by six weeks because of the tooling delay.

Runbook — account recovery for the Tidecal sync bot

If the calendar sync bot gets locked out again (usually after the Marwick conflict-resolver retries itself into oblivion), don't panic and don't delete the account. Just pause the sync queue, clear the stale conflict flags, and kick off manual recovery from the admin panel. When prompted during recovery, enter the passphrase noted right below.

vault phrase of yahop-yahaf = druael-fraion

## Onboarding: Farebranch Rules Engine

Plugin authors integrate with Farebranch by registering fee rules against the evaluation API. Rules are sandboxed; they cannot perform network calls directly. All rate-table lookups go through the host, which validates your plugin manifest at load time. Your local env file must include the signing credential the host uses to verify manifests, set on the next line.

secret setting of bajef-fajof: COURIER_KEY3=76c